About Bruer

Bruer is a manufacturing and retail startup, founded in 2013 by Gabe Herz and Andy Clark. The company, which is yet to disclose its headquarters, was born out of the shared passion for coffee and design of the co-founders. Gabe, holding a BS in Mechanical Engineering, and Andy, with a BFA in Industrial Design and experience in Chinese manufacturing, have come together to create Bruer, a company dedicated to producing quality products that celebrate the art of brewing coffee. Their vision is to emphasize the ritual and intimate process behind brewing, recognizing every step as part of an artistic creation.
